    Abstract

    As the intelligent mobile phone stores more and more users’ privacy information, the privacy information security in mobile terminal has become more and more important to mobile users. So how to protect the sensitive information of mobile phone users has become the focus of research in recent years. This paper analyzed the security mechanism of iOS platform and security status and development of iOS Apps, and then proposed a scheme–iOS software sensitive information analysis and security assessment system, for detection of iOS analysis software of leaking sensitive information. The system is used to detect whether APPs in iOS platform is revealing user privacy data, and make evaluation of safety grade according to the severity of privacy disclosure of APPs. We give an evaluation algorithm about security level for evaluating the severity of APPs. This system is the overall solution of the iOS application software acquisition, privacy leak detection and security assessment.
